Earth Gay 2022

Sign up

Share

FacebookLinkedInTweetEmail

When

May 7, 2022 at 11:00 am

Location

Heron's Nest Community Center 4818 15th Ave SW

When: May 7th – 11am-3pm 

Location: Heron’s Nest @ the West Duwamish Greenbelt

Registration link: https://seattle.greencitypartnerships.org/event/21192/

Event Description: Join a community of queer environmentalists for Earth Gay 2022! Green Seattle Partnership, Herons Nest, Washington Environmental Council, QPOC Hikers, and Patagonia are partnering to host this inclusive celebration of the Earth. This event is open to everyone, including LGBTQ+ folx and our allies.

We’ll be enjoying lots of fun activities and giveaways at the Heron’s Nest including: environmental stewardship, birding, artists, activities, and more. Join us to help restore our park and celebrate Earth the queer way!

We are honored to live and work on the traditional and ancestral lands of the Nations whose current lands we call Washington, including the Chehalis, Chinook, Colville, Cowlitz, Duwamish, Hoh, Jamestown, Kalispel, Kikiallus, Lower Elwha, Lummi, Makah, Marietta Band, Muckleshoot, Nisqually, Nooksack, Palouse, Port Gamble, Puyallup, Quileute, Quinault, Samish, Sauk-Suiattle, Shoalwater, Skokomish, Snohomish, Snoqualmie, Snoqualmoo, Spokane, Squaxin Island, Steilacoom, Stillaguamish, Suquamish, Swinomish, Tulalip, Upper Skagit, Wanapum, And Yakama Nations. We recognize that borders are artificial—many tribal nations from the North, the South, and the East of present-day Washington also have historical and current ties to these lands.

We express our gratitude as guests and thank the original and current stewards of this land. What we experience today is a product of these nations’ ancestors’ ability to be in relationship with the natural world. We would not be here without their guardianship and connection to the earth.

We also acknowledge Black and African labor on which this country built its prosperity—we honor you.
